The Game is inspired by The Great Giana Sisters that was developed for Commodore 64 by Time Warp Productions in 1987. The levels are all new, while the game play looks pretty much like original.
The name of the game origins from Giana 8-bit, while 8 bits are one byte.
Game has 30 levels with boss on last. Spider boss can be killed only by shooting. A lot of shooting.
Most of the monsters you can kill by jumping on their head. Don't try to kill yellow worms, piranhas, yellow aliens or bouncing red balls, because you can't. Beware of the quick sand, it disappears quickly after you step on it.
